Linux vim 설정하기
1. vim의 정의
- Linux vim 이란?
vim 은 문서를 편집하는 텍스트기반 에디터 프로그램인 vi 를 향상시킨 문서 편집기 입니다. |
- Linux vim 설정이란?
vim 을 사용자가 원하는 형태로 구성하여 쓸 수 있도록 설정파일을 수정해주는 것을 말합니다. 개별 사용자별로 설정파일을 수정하기 위해서는 ~/.vimrc 파일을 수정해주어야 하며, 사용자와 무관하게 설정하기 위해서는 /etc/vimrc 파일을 수정해주어야 합니다. 설정파일을 통해 수정할 수 있는 것은 자동들여쓰기, 줄번호 표시, 탭과 들여쓰기 간격, 구문강조, 괄호 강조, 색상 설정등 다양하게 존재하며, 이를 원하는 형태로 설정해두면 앞으로 vim을 쓸 때마다 동일하게 사용하실 수 있습니다. |
2. vim 설정파일 접근방법
- 개별 사용자 설정파일 접근방법
[root@localhost ~]# vim ~/.vimrc
|
- 전체 설정 파일 접근방법
[root@localhost ~]# vim /etc/vimrc
|
3. vim 설정
옵션 | 설명 |
set autoindent | 자동 들여쓰기가 되도록 설정 |
set cindent | C 언어 파일 수정시 들여쓰기가 되도록 설정 |
set tabstop = n (숫자) | 탭 넓이를 n 만큼 띄움 |
set shiftwidth = n (숫자) | 들여쓰기 간격을 n 만큼 띄움 |
syntax on | 구문강조 표시 설정 |
set showmatch | 선택된 괄호와 짝을 이루는 괄호에 대해 강조 |
set ignorecase | 대소문자 구별없이 검색하도록 설정 |
set number | 줄번호를 표시 |
4. vim 설정 예제
- 예제
아래의 항목에 맞게 vim을 설정하시오.
|
항목 |
자동 들여쓰기 설정 |
탭넓이와 들여쓰기 간격 4 |
줄번호 표시 |
[root@localhost ~]# vim /etc/vimrc
|